Managing Pictures

Storing Pictures

Your DC40 camera can store up to 48 pictures by default, however the
camera software application allows you to change camera features
which may impact the actual number that can be stored. Refer to the
camera software documentation for more information.

By default, the display shows you the number of pictures that you can
take before the camera is full. As you take pictures, the picture count in
the display decreases. For example, let’s say that you are about to take
pictures and the count displays “27.” After taking two pictures, the count
displays “25.” When the camera is full, the count displays “0” and the “0”
flashes if you press the shutter button. No pictures can be taken at this
point until you have deleted stored pictures.

Erasing Pictures

Once you have transferred stored pictures to your computer, you should
erase them from the camera to make room for new pictures.
